Ian Dunt on the continued fallout over the death of 18 year old Southampton University student Henry Nowak. In the US, a radical movement known as ‘masculinism’ wants to repel the advances of feminism. And this weekend (June 14), Switzerland will vote on a referendum proposal to cap its population at 10 million. But it remains unclear how such a “cap” would work, particularly in a nation with large companies that rely on skilled migrant labour. Guests:Ian Dunt, iNews columnist and regular LNL commentatorHelen Lewis, staff writer for the Atlantic Mercedes Ruehl , Switzerland and Austria correspondent for the Financial Times
